Maybe the potentially reduced clearance with parking blocks for US-market cars is the reason? The lip would surely get torn off in some scenarios. On my stock ride height G80 with the aero skirt installed, there is about 5” from ground to the lowest point of the lip, versus about 6.75” to lowest edge of the front end (without the lip).

Driver's Side Window Switch: 61-31-6-847-099
Passenger Side/Rear Window Switch: 61-31-9-299-457
Driver Side Lock: 61-31-5-A95-757
Passenger Side Lock: 61-31-5-A95-758

If you have an M3, you will need qty x3 of 61-31-9-299-457. Same window switch used in front passenger and front doors. I will admit after doing it, I don't ever want to do it again
